Dr. Monica Rankin, Professor of History at the University of Texas has brought social media into the classroom to increase the level of engagement of students. The experiment is perhaps too early to raise a final verdict on, however, comments from the students and the teachers sound promising.

The innate fear of looking and more importantly sounding 'stupid' in front of classmates is minimized by the semi-anonymous text message arguments flying across the screen. Cited as a source for study notes by the students, and a method of text reduction (140 character limit) by the instructor, this new technology sounds like a great marriage between humans and technology.
